Q: How is the Sprocket Driven Cable Reeling Drum used in industrial settings?

A: The Sprocket Driven Cable Reeling Drum is used for managing and retracting cables in equipment such as EOT cranes, coke ovens, amusement park rides, and storage systems, ensuring smooth and safe cable handling during operation.

Q: When should I consider replacing or maintaining the cable reeling drum?

A: Regular maintenance is recommended for optimal performance, and the drum should be replaced if you notice abnormal wear, decreased tension, or any mechanical failure during inspection.
